Passive follow-up means: - ANS-Checking the hospital database for readmission of
patients in the registry database.
What is a descriptive analysis to evaluate cancer occurrences in a certain location or
during a certain time period called? - ANS-cancer cluster
Cases not required to be included on the reportable list are those that include patients
seen only in consultation to establish or confirm a diagnosis or treatment plan. T/F -
ANS-true
The first truly population-based registry in the US was the: - ANS-Connecticut Cancer
Registry
A non-population registry collects information from multiple facilities not confined to a
geographic area. T/F - ANS-true
What is a descriptive analysis to evaluate cancer occurrences in a certain location or
during a certain time period called? - ANS-Cancer cluster
In 1973, the National Cancer Institute established the SEER program. SEER is an
acronym for: - ANS-Surveillance, Epidemiology and End Results
State central registries: a. provide incidence data b. population based. c. multipurpose.
d. all answers correct - ANS-d. all answers correct
The National Cancer Data Base is an example of: - ANS-a non population based central
registry
You are in compliance with HIPAA if you are having a confidential conversation with a
fellow provider, even if there is the possibility of being overheard. T/F - ANS-True
NAACCR Guidelines state that staffing needs for state/central registries should be: -
ANS-Based on the estimated annual caseload of the registry.
